Abstract

The habitat loss can exert great ecological impact on animal populations. One of the most common causes for the decrease of habitat and ambiental alteration is the growing urbanization. the anthropogenic pressure can also exert great influence in the population dynamics. The São Paulo municipality fits in this scene, because is the greater in the country and have several forest fragments in its interior. The pitviper Bothrops jararaca is on of the most common species in the municipality and can be found across its territory. The aim of the present research is to compare ecological characters in two populations of B. jararaca evaluating the fragmentation effects caused by urban growth. The populations will be compared in relation to abundance and body size of the individuals. We going to evaluate the food availability and the predators pressure on the locals of each population lives. The study will take place in two municipal parks of São Paulo, one of them composed by continuous forest area and other a isolated forest remnant surrounded by the city. For snake data collection, active searches (Time Constrained Search), traps (pitfalls and Sherman) and also artificial shelters will be adopted. Specimens donated to the Instituto Butantan, from one of the study locals will be used too. Traps will provide information about prey availability and predation will be evaluated with the aid of clay models. The field work will last twelve months, with four days visits on each park. (AU)
